Ruling

1. I have considered the appellant’s notice of motion dated 1st July 2024, the certificate of urgency issued by Bernard Otieno Esquire advocate on even date and the supporting affidavit of Jackline Ndungú also sworn on even date and I am persuaded of the need to stay the proceedings of the trial court and I thus make the following orders:-1. This application is not certified as urgent.2. An order of stay of proceedings of Kisumu CMCC E215 of 2023 – Mercy Awino Otieno t/a Tacom Ventures vs Sidian Bank Limited and Another is hereby issued pending the hearing and determination of this application.3. The appellant is directed to serve this application within 2 days from the date hereof.4. The respondents are directed to file and serve their responses within 7 days from the date hereof and the Plaintiff is granted leave to file any further affidavit if need be within 10 days from the date hereof.5. The appellant is directed to file their submissions within 15 days from the date hereof and the respondent to do so within 20 days from the date hereof.6. Mention on 24. 7.2024 to confirm compliance.
